One thing that most of Cotto's fans have overlooked so far when it comes to Cotto's jab, which is great btw, is that Pacman is a Southpaw, which means they will be mirroring each other since both lead hands are on the same side. It will be more like fencing or escrima, were both jabs will nullify each other, or should I say, Cotto's jabs will be nullified more than Pacquiao, since Pacman throws his jabs faster, he will have more success.

                The key to a Cotto win is his right hand, which he should use more often against Pacquiao if he wants to keep Pacman at bay. Marquez showed how to neutralize Pacman by taking the initiative and using his overhand right more often as his had Pacman stopped on his tracks at lot of times...
